Limited Submission: Alcon Research Institute Young Investigator Grant

Discipline/Subject Area: Clinicians and scientists in vision research and ophthalmology

Alcon Research Institute Young Investigator Grant Eligibility and Guidelines: Open to all members of the vision science community who are actively involved in independent research efforts (e.g. academics, engineers, clinician scientists, etc.). Members of the Alcon Research Institute Scientific Selection Committee and Alcon Research Institute Executive Committee are not eligible to apply.

    • Along with the application, applicants should submit an up-to-date NIH-style bio-sketch or detailed CV, an up-to-date photo, and a letter of reference, preferably from the department head.
    • Only two applications are permitted from a given institution. If more than two applications are submitted, a note will be sent to the head of the department asking him/her to decide on the top two applicants.
    • The maximum grant amount is $75,000. The grant will be applied to support the research program of the grant recipient at their institution
    • A maximum of no more than 10% can be taken from the grant by the institution for Indirect Costs.
    • Applicants must be devoting at least 50% of their time toward research.
    • Grant date can be no more than eight years post training
    • No requirements based on Rank/Level/Title but Applicants must not yet have attained R-level grant status or equivalent. Candidate must be appointed or nominated to the assistant professor level (either research or tenure track). Associate professors are allowed, provided they are 8 years or less.
